アダプターモジュールによるパラメータ効率的転移学習(Adapter-based Parameter-Efficient Transfer Learning)

田中専務

拓海先生、最近部下から「アダプタを入れてモデルを軽くする」と聞きまして。要するに高いGPUを買わずにAIを使えるという話ですか?

AIメンター拓海

素晴らしい着眼点ですね!まず結論を3つで言うと、1) 大きなモデルを丸ごと更新せずに適応できる、2) 学習コストと保存コストが小さい、3) 現場で段階的に導入しやすい、ですよ。

田中専務

学習コストが小さいと言われてもピンときません。たとえば、今使っている業務データを学習させるのにどれほど時間やお金がかからないのですか?

AIメンター拓海

良い問いです。専門用語を使わずに言うと、巨大な工場(大モデル)の機械を全部入れ替える代わりに、小さなアタッチメント(アダプタ)を追加して特定の製品ラインに合わせるイメージです。だから時間も計算資源も少なくて済むんです。

田中専務

これって要するに、全部作り直すより部分的に変えた方が安上がりということ?それなら投資対効果が出やすそうですが、精度は落ちないんでしょうか?

AIメンター拓海

その点も非常に重要です。多くのケースで精度はほとんど落ちず、むしろ少ないデータで安定して適応できるメリットがあります。要点は3つで、1) 精度とコストのバランス、2) 導入の段階的実行、3) 運用時の差し替え容易性、です。

田中専務

現場導入の不安があるのですが、保守やアップデートは難しくなりませんか?全部お任せでクラウドに置くしかないのでは、と心配です。

AIメンター拓海

大丈夫です、拓海の経験上、アダプタ方式はオンプレミスでもクラウドでも柔軟に使えます。簡単に言うと、コアはそのままにして周辺だけを差し替えるので、保守作業は限定的になるんです。

田中専務

費用対効果の試算はどうすれば良いですか。試験的にやる場合、どの指標を見れば投資判断できますか?

AIメンター拓海

経営判断向けには3つのKPIを見てください。1) 学習にかかる時間とコスト、2) 本番での精度改善量、3) 運用コストの削減見込み。これらをパイロットで測ればROIはかなり正確に出ますよ。

田中専務

わかりました。最後に一つだけ確認させてください。現場のデータが少なくても成果が出るというのは、うちのような中小製造業でも実用的という理解でよろしいですか?

AIメンター拓海

その通りです。小規模データでも効率よく適応できるのがアダプタの強みです。大きな投資を先にする必要はなく、小さく始めて効果を見ながら拡張できますよ。大丈夫、一緒にやれば必ずできますよ。

田中専務

なるほど。ではまずは1ラインだけパイロットで試し、コストと精度の改善を測って判断するということで間違いない、と私の言葉で言うとそういうことですね。

1. 概要と位置づけ

結論を端的に述べる。アダプタ(adapter)を用いたパラメータ効率的転移学習(Parameter-Efficient Transfer Learning)は、大規模事前学習済みモデルを丸ごと更新するのではなく、小さな追加モジュールだけを学習してモデルを特定タスクに適応させる手法である。これにより学習に必要な計算資源と保存すべきモデルサイズを大幅に削減できる点が従来手法と異なる最大の意義である。

基礎的に、従来のファインチューニング(fine-tuning)はモデル全体の重みを更新するため、学習用のGPUやストレージが多く必要であり、中小企業や現場での実運用に障害となっていた。アダプタ方式はこの障壁を取り除き、少量のデータと低コストな計算で実用的な結果を得られるため、現場導入の敷居を下げる。

ビジネス視点では、初期投資を抑えた試験導入が可能になる点が重要だ。モデルを一律で買い替えるのではなく、業務ごとに小さなモジュールを追加することで、費用対効果の検証を段階的に行える。したがって導入リスクが低く、意思決定もしやすくなる。

本稿ではまず、なぜアダプタが効率的なのかを技術的に整理し、次に先行研究との違いと実験での有効性、最後に導入時の検討事項と今後の課題を経営者向けに解説する。忙しい経営者でも迅速に要点を掴めるように構成している。

結論ファーストで示したポイントは一貫しており、以降の各節では実務判断に必要な情報に絞って説明を行う。検索に使える英語キーワードは最後に列挙する。

2. 先行研究との差別化ポイント

従来研究は主に二つのアプローチに分かれる。一つはモデル全体を微調整するフルファインチューニング(full fine-tuning)であり、もう一つは重みの一部のみを固定する低ランク分解や部分更新の手法である。これらは精度という面では有利だが、コスト面での負担が大きい。

アダプタ方式は、モデル本体の重みは固定したまま、小さな追加層のみを学習する点が差別化要因である。これによりパラメータ更新量が劇的に減り、学習時間と保存すべきバージョン数も削減できるため、運用側の工数も下がる。

先行手法と比べた際のもう一つの違いは適応性だ。アダプタは業務ごとに異なる小モジュールを付け替える設計が可能で、複数顧客や複数部署で同じコアモデルを共有しつつ差分だけ管理できる。これが中長期的な運用コストの低減につながる。

研究上の評価軸も変わりつつある。単純な精度比較だけではなく、学習コスト、保存コスト、デプロイ時の柔軟性といった実務に直結する指標を同時に評価する点で、本手法は実用志向の研究として位置づけられる。

要するに、精度だけでなく導入・運用の現実的な負担を含めて比較すると、アダプタ方式は中小企業の現場にフィットする選択肢として優位性があると評価できる。

3. 中核となる技術的要素

テクニカルに言うとアダプタ(adapter)はニューラルネットワークの特定層に挿入される小さな学習可能モジュールである。通常は低次元の変換層と非線形活性化で構成され、元のモデルの出力を短時間でタスク特化に変換する。

ここで登場する専門用語を整理する。Transfer Learning(転移学習)は事前学習済みモデルを別タスクへ適応する技術であり、Fine-Tuning(微調整)はその具体的手法である。Adapterはその微調整を効率化するためのモジュールであり、ビジネスでは工場の付属装置のように考えると分かりやすい。

実装面ではアダプタのサイズや挿入位置、正則化の工夫が性能に影響する。重要なのは必要最小限のパラメータで十分な適応が得られるバランスを設計することだ。これにより学習時間とモデル管理コストを最小化できる。

さらに、アダプタは複数タスクでの共有や差し替えが容易であるため、マルチテナント環境での運用にも向いている。企業が複数部署でAIを使う場合でも、コアは一本化して差分だけを管理できる点が運用負担を下げる。

要約すると、アダプタの技術的要点は小さな追加で大きな効果を得る設計思想にあり、現場の制約を踏まえた実用性が中核である。

4. 有効性の検証方法と成果

論文や実務報告では、有効性を評価する際に三つの軸を用いる。第一に精度(task performance)、第二に学習コスト(compute cost)、第三に保存・配布コスト(storage/deployment)。これらを同時に報告することで実運用上の価値が明確になる。

典型的な実験では、同一の事前学習済みコアを用いてフルファインチューニングとアダプタ方式を比較する。結果として、多くのタスクでアダプタはほぼ同等の精度を達成しつつ、学習時の総パラメータ更新量を数%に抑えられるという成果が示されている。

ビジネス上のインパクト試算では、GPU時間やクラウド費用の削減、モデルバージョンごとの保存コスト低減が明確に見える化される。特に複数顧客・複数用途でモデルを展開する場合、差分のみを保存する設計は運用コストを大きく下げる。

ただし検証にあたっては評価データの偏りや実運用でのスケール問題にも注意が必要であり、パイロットフェーズで現場データに基づく再評価を行うことが勧められている。実証は段階的に行うべきだ。

総じて、研究成果は理論と実運用の両面でアダプタ方式の有効性を支持しており、中小企業でも現実的に試験導入できる根拠を提供している。

5. 研究を巡る議論と課題

議論の焦点は主に三点に集約される。第一に、アダプタの設計最適化問題であり、どのサイズ・どの位置に挿入するかの自動化はまだ研究途上である。第二に、セキュリティとデータプライバシーであり、現場データを用いる際のガバナンス設計が必要だ。

第三の課題は長期運用でのドリフト対応である。差分モジュールだけを更新する運用は効率的だが、時間経過での基盤モデルとの不整合が生じる可能性がある。この場合、定期的なコアモデルの再評価と必要に応じた統合更新が求められる。

また、商用利用におけるライセンスや依存関係の問題も無視できない。事前学習モデルのライセンス条件を把握し、差分モジュールの公開・配布ポリシーを整えることが企業としての責任だ。

研究コミュニティはこれらの課題に対する技術的・運用的解を模索しており、今後の標準化やベストプラクティスの確立が期待される。経営判断としてはこれらのリスクを理解した上で段階的導入を進めることが現実的である。

最後に、現場での人的スキル要件も見逃せない。現状は外部ベンダーや社内の数名の専門家で運用するケースが多く、内製化のための人材育成計画が必要である。

6. 今後の調査・学習の方向性

今後の研究課題としては、アダプタの自動探索と効率的な圧縮、そして継続学習(continual learning)との統合が挙げられる。特に自動化は現場の工数を削減するための鍵となる。

また、産業用途におけるベンチマークの整備も重要だ。製造業や物流といった分野特化の評価指標を作り、実運用との乖離を縮める努力が必要である。これにより経営層はより信頼できる判断材料を得られる。

教育面では、経営層向けのKPI設計やパイロット計画のテンプレート化が求められる。現場の非専門家でも意思決定ができるよう、技術的指標を経営指標に翻訳する実務知が重要だ。

最終的には、初期投資を抑えた段階的導入と明確な評価フローを組むことで、中小企業でも継続的に価値を生み出せる体制が構築される。研究と実務の橋渡しが今後の鍵である。

検索に使える英語キーワード: Adapter modules, Parameter-efficient transfer learning, Fine-tuning alternatives, Model compression, Continual learning.

会議で使えるフレーズ集

「まず小さく始めて効果を検証しましょう。アダプタ方式なら初期投資を抑えつつ精度改善の見込みが確認できます。」

「評価指標は精度だけでなく、学習コストと運用コストも同時に見ましょう。これがROIを正しく評価するコツです。」

「現場データでのパイロットを提案します。1ライン分のデータで、学習時間と精度改善の実測を取りましょう。」

引用元: Smith A.B., “Adapter-based Parameter-Efficient Transfer Learning,” arXiv preprint arXiv:2401.01234v1, 2024.

AIBRプレミアム

関連する記事

AI Business Reviewをもっと見る

今すぐ購読し、続きを読んで、すべてのアーカイブにアクセスしましょう。

続きを読む